Scritto da: Erika Temprano
Very wide and quite long
I love gap because they tend to have pretty good quality clothes. These jeans are well made and feel like they'll last me a while. The white is super pretty and not shear at all. They fit me a bit big but I think thats because I often switch between a 27 and 28 and should've sized down with these. These jeans are definitely very wide leg, to the point that they can look quite big when you're wearing them. They're also a bit long but I'm also pretty short so that's probably why. Most of the issues I have with these jeans is just because of the style and not the make of the jeans. So I would say they're pretty nice if you like very wide jeans and pick the right size.

Scritto da: Alex B.
Big in the crotch and hips
I have a 40-41” hips and 38” waist. I chose size 12 based on my measurement. The waist fit comfortably and perfectly but the I was swimming in the hips. These look like mom jeans on me even when I tried to pull them up like a high waist. I didn’t think these were flattering for my body type. The hem is unfinished but the length was great.
